Eat Right: Traditional Food Wisdom to Sustain Us Today Gebundene Ausgabe – 14. Januar 2016
This comprehensive guide will show you how to find true nourishment and pleasure in the discovery, preparation and eating of real food and drink. It's not about fashionable dieting or being anxious about food choices, it's about positive eating. Techniques include making your own butter, yogurt, ghee, lard, broth, dairy and water kefir, kombucha, coconut water, kimchi, sauerkraut, sourdough, as well as sprouting grains and activating nuts and seeds. And there are also 100 wholesome recipes that encourage the use of good animal fats, well-fed meat, sprouted grains, local and seasonal produce, which will leave you feeling happy and satisfied. This is an easy book to dip into for advice, inspiration and truly health-giving recipes.

5,0 von 5 Sternen Sugar Free Junkie: Book Of The Month!
This book was Sugar Free Junkie's 'Book of the Month' for June. It isn't often you can really enjoy READING a cook book. I'm used to 'ooo-ing' as I scan over recipes (and then only making the ones with the nicest photos or fewest ingredients). But this book (and it is a book, not just a cook book) took me by surprise. It has taken permanent residence on the coffee table because above all, it is INTERESTING! 'EAT RIGHT gives us a tool to make not just good, but informed choices amidst busy normal lives.
Nick Barnard (co-founder of RUDE HEALTH) takes the reader back to basics and explains in a positive way not just how but why we should ‘EAT RIGHT'. The book is packed with easy-to-follow recipes alongside well-written information about ingredients, the recipes’ origins, and nutritional properties. It’s like a cookbook got frisky with a dictionary. A food education! A fooducation! It starts with a short introduction before going on to cover all main food groups with – HURRAH! – some everyday recipes too. Burgers, pizza, biscuits, mash - the list goes on and there’s even alcohol. Not to mention some real dinner party showstoppers and more time-intensive processes like fermenting and bread-making.
I give it 5*s. If you’re like me and the closest you regularly get to a farmers’ market is watching Countryfile on a Sunday evening - don't panic: this book still works. Nick Barnard has done a great job of bringing the everyday kitchen an everyday book which will not so much sit on the shelf but takeover the counter. It is informative about real food without making the reader feel out of depth. At £19.99 (on Amazon) it isn't cheap, but when you take into account how many recipes there are (all natural ingredients and free from refined sugar) this is actually a fantastic investment. I guarantee there will be something for you in here.
